rEAD PLEASE AND ANY HELP WOULD BE GREATLY APPRECIATED

(me)hi, i have a 2003 arctic cat 250 2x4 and i want some more power in it, one of my friends told me i should look into getting a new exhaust system, i dont know much at all about this and was curious if anyone knew of an exhaust system that would help my fourwheelers power but not to expensive, and also after i get one, he said something about a jet system and air intake? im not familiar with this, do i need one when i get my exhaust, thanks alot for your help
?

(AWNSER) a new pipe will add a nice gain and you will need to rejet because of the pipe. a dynojet kit will help with power as well. if you add a high flow air filter you will have to rejet as well.

(ME) k so is this dyno kit an exhaust kit or what, will it replace my muffler, and if i get this is need a new air intake? do you recommend any kind, what all would i need? annd the dyno kit, is it a pretty good one, i looked it up, do u think it would help alot in my take off?and what about sound, i like a muscle sound would it change it at all? thanks alot

(ME) ooh ok so your saying after i get the muffler or exhaust kit i need i need the dynokit with it, ok, and i looked i cant find any that says it will work with a arctic cat 2003 250 2x4

i have a speedwerx pipe on my 400 and it made a great improvement. im not sure if anyone makes a pipe for the 250 youll have to look around. you can try gutting out your current pipe. it will be significantly louder though. a pipe from speedwerx will add a nice low growl and will add alot of low end. but by adding the pipe or gutting the exhaust the motor is breathing better so you will need to up your pilot jet. the pilot jet controls fuel flow from just off idle to i believe quarter throttle. so the engine will want more fuel for the pilot circuit. the dynojet kit is jets for the carb as well as an adjustable fuel needle. the new fuel needle will make a new fuel curve and its adjustable so you can get better tuneability for the midrange. so yes the dynojet kit will help low end. you wont need to alter your intake for either of these mods. an aftermarket air filter will help but it will also require you to rejet. adding 2" snorkels to your air intake will give you great gain as well but yup you guessed it youll need to rejet. but its going to be tough to find mods for the 250. but a new high flow air filter 2" snorkels and a pipe and rejetting will give you a great gain. if you can find a dynojet kit for the 250 go for it.

http://www.dynojet.com/jetkits/atv/arctic.aspx can u take a look at the second one down on the list, is this what i need, and that info was really helpful thanks alot, and ya im having alot of trouble finding an exhuast system that will fit, would a universal exhaust slip on pipe work? and the rejetting part i dont know how to do that, wouyld it be easier to take it to a atv shop and let them do it? or is it really simple, and by guttin do u mean taking out all the old pipes tht connect form the mufler to the engine and putting a new set in form there? thanks alot

thats the dyno jet ya need right there. as far as a universal pipe those are usually to make your atv quieter and can reduce power. if you take your current pipe off and cut the end cap off with a sawzall and drill out the baffles inside you will make the pipe free flowing thus making more power. but more noise as well. or if your pipe has a spark arrestor you can buy a tube that bolts in place of the spark arrestor that will make a little more power. as far as rejetting your dealer can do it but im sure it will cost ya a pretty penny. jetting is basically changing the jets in the carb up or down depending on a rich or lean condition. rich condition will make a black spark plug and will require you to go down a size in jetting. a lean condition means your not getting enough fuel and you will need to go up a jet size. but this is all very vague as there is alot more to it. there is a pilot circuit a main curcuit and midrange. the dyno jet kit will walk you through how to install there product according to what you have installed on your machine for mods. but its just a bassis to start off of. you will need to figure out how your atv is runnning after that. if youde like pm me your email address and ill send you a bunch of info on jetting. with some very helpful tips and tricks.
